The drive from Martins Ferry, OH to Kettering, OH covers 203.9 miles and takes about 3h 51m behind the wheel. This route is realistic as a one-day drive if you keep your stops efficient.
The route leans on I 70, West Freeway, I 675 for much of the mileage, and the overall profile is highway-focused drive. The longest uninterrupted segment is about 125.1 miles on I 70. At current regular gas prices, budget about $31.64 one way before food or hotel costs.
